#117997From: Larry FridkisJun 22, 1995 10:25 AM
Can you recommend a system ie recorder/software for making cd's for some software I have created. The most data would be about 500meg in pcx files exe files only 200K. Need easy system to create masters. Thanks larry
#118112From: Georges BrownJun 24, 1995 4:43 AM
It is so hard to recomend drives these days…. How many discs will you be making? How many each time? How many copies of each disc? What is the host system? Do you see Mac or hybrid discs in your future? Cheers, Georges CD Archive, Inc. http://www.cdarchive.com
#118233From: Larry FridkisJun 26, 1995 9:25 PM
Georges, I probably will make 10-20 per month, all windows no mac. Would like to use for music in the future as well. the music is just for 1 disk fun stuff. Thanks for your help. Larry
#118235From: Georges BrownJun 26, 1995 9:47 PM
Larry, I hate doing this but… I have two favorite drives right now but we are now testing the new SONY so I may change my mind in a week or two 🙂 The Philips CDD 522 and Kodak PCD 225. They are basically the same drive. Kodak added the feature to read Photo CD bar codes, this is a nice feature if you ever plan to implement something with the disc transporter. Both drivesa cost about the same… Kodak includes 25 discs the Philips includes software. Both handle audio well enough to make your "fun" discs.
